Music is a funny thing. An original sound comes out and everyone loves it. Months later, hundreds of bands follow in their predecessor's footsteps, and a phenomenon known as "falling off of the face of the planet" happens.

Vanishing Point Records artist, Last Second, really, never should have been signed. The vocals are off, the guitars are monotonous, and the drums are average. This is the problem with music, not enough people are original, and then, individuals end up spending their money on a disc better suited for a coaster than for putting in a CD player.

One good point on this CD is the vocals on one lone song. The band attempts to do hardcore, and, strangely enough, nail it. The song is both well played and well vocalized. If Against All Odds wants any credibility in this current music scene, full of lobotomized clone bands, they should stick with hardcore music. They seem to have a knack for it. Well, either that or they just don't have a knack for punk.
